Chapter 15. Using Scripts for Consistent Administration

The Microsoft Windows scripting infrastructure has grown dramatically since the late 1990s, and Windows Server 2008 is the first server operating system with a powerful scripting language and command shell built in to the operating system—Windows PowerShell. All versions of Windows Server 2008 except Server Core versions have PowerShell available as a feature.
